Issue/Introduction
What does the Patch Management Software Update Plug-in check to see if a reboot is required?
Environment
Patch Management Solution 7.5.x, 7.6.x and 8.x
Resolution
The check for this is found on the Client at H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Altiris\Altiris Agent\Patch Management - 'RebootRequired' with a value of (1):
If the value is (0) then no reboot is required.
Additional Notes:
This registry key will not be populated for manually installed updates. The reg key is only created when the Patch Management Solution installs an update that requires a reboot.
This registry key is not displayed until an update requiring a reboot is applied. Then the registry key is created. The Reboot Schedule will reboot the machine with a command for Windows to reboot on the scheduled time.
This registry key is removed from the Client's registry following a reboot by the Software Update Plug-in.
